Today, in our 47th year fighting for the protection of our town’s beloved mountain, the ink is now dry on conservation easements which will declare a forever mine-free Red Lady. High Country Conservation Advocates (HCCA), the Town, key partners, numerous supporters, and you, have all showed a tremendous amount of dedication at one or more…

Celebrate the start of the film festival with this most famous CB tradition: a fun-filled, meandering bike ride through the streets and alleys of Crested Butte. Bring your townie bike and join us! Costumes optional, but encouraged! Meet up at 2nd and Elk. Everyone is welcome. Free event.
